Transaction 84e250f394c97a6a6b5b3ef3e7cb76feaf6aec97155f89c61b22ef1d736c56ef
2 Input
1 Outputs
- 84e250f394c97a6a6b5b3ef3e7cb76feaf6aec97155f89c61b22ef1d736c56ef:0
value 7342760
address 1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c